OVH Cloud OVH Cloud

numérotation de ligne

3 réponses
Avatar
jean-luc
bonjour,

en même temps que je découvre le langage ruby je découvre aussi emacs.
J'aimerai pouvoir écrire mes fichiers ruby avec une numérotation de
ligne (plus facile pour si retrouver avec les messages d'erreur) existe
t'il une commande emacs affichant une numérotation mais sans quel soit
dans le fichier lui même (dans une marge de la fenêtre plutôt) ? et
existe t'il un mode ruby pour emacs ?

merci bien JL

3 réponses

Avatar
Sébastien Kirche
Le 14 septembre 2005 à 21:09, jean-luc a dit :

bonjour,

en même temps que je découvre le langage ruby je découvre aussi emacs.
J'aimerai pouvoir écrire mes fichiers ruby avec une numérotation de
ligne (plus facile pour si retrouver avec les messages d'erreur)
existe t'il une commande emacs affichant une numérotation mais sans
quel soit dans le fichier lui même (dans une marge de la fenêtre
plutôt) ?



C'est marrant, je crois avoir vu passer la même question aujourd'hui ?
Oui, il y a le module setnu qui est inspiré de vi :
http://www.emacswiki.org/cgi-bin/wiki/LineNumbers

et existe t'il un mode ruby pour emacs ?



Oui. D'après l'emacs-wiki il est même livré avec Ruby.
Plus d'infos sur le wiki :
http://www.emacswiki.org/cgi-bin/wiki/RubyMode

HTH.
--
Sébastien Kirche
Avatar
Matthieu Moy
jean-luc writes:

en même temps que je découvre le langage ruby je découvre aussi emacs.
J'aimerai pouvoir écrire mes fichiers ruby avec une numérotation de
ligne (plus facile pour si retrouver avec les messages d'erreur)



M-x goto-line RET (a binder sur une touche pour avoir un racourcis)

(line-number-mode 1) dans ~/.emacs.el pour avoir la ligne courrante
dans la modeline.

--
Matthieu
Avatar
drkm
jean-luc writes:

(plus facile pour si retrouver avec les messages d'erreur)



S'il existe un mode pour Ruby, il y a même de grandes chances
qu'il fournisse un moyen d'utiliser 'next-error' de manière
intéressante, ce qui serait plus utile.

--drkm